: If a BIOS update is interrupted by a power failure, or if the firmware becomes corrupted, the laptop may refuse to turn on entirely (a state known as being "bricked"). In this state, software recovery tools cannot run. A technician must desolder the BIOS chip or use a programming clip to manually flash a working file onto the chip. : Always back up your original BIOS using a programmer before attempting any flash. If your machine is completely dead and you cannot back it up, double-check your motherboard model against the bin file you plan to use. As noted by repair professionals, using a mismatched dump can often lead to further instability.
